Frequently asked questions

Membership is open to a range of organisations and professionals across the early childhood education and care sector, including providers of early learning services, kindergartens, OSHC services, family day care services, occasional care services, as well as community organisations, individuals and sector stakeholders.

Memberships start from $399 per year. Pricing may vary depending on the type and size of your organisation.

Members receive access to expert advice, helpdesk support, governance and compliance resources, professional learning opportunities, coaching and mentoring, webinars, consultancy discounts and sector updates.

Yes. Members receive a 25% discount on training and professional development opportunities (excludes professional membership for individuals).

ITAV can provide guidance on governance, compliance, workforce and HR matters, policy development, operational issues, service management, regulatory requirements and sector developments.

Yes. Advocacy is a core part of our work. ITAV represents the interests of community-based children’s services and contributes to sector discussions, policy development and government engagement.

No. ITAV supports a wide range of children’s services, including kindergartens, Outside School Hours Care, family day care, occasional care services and other organisations working within the ECEC sector.
